I worked in Clip Studio for a long time in Animation, here’s a couple of things!
If you want to easily Copy+Paste parts of your drawing, I’d HIGHLY RECOMMEND always using groups/folders for your frames!! Instead of merging your layers outside of the animation folder.
The fill/paint bucket tool also has a “Close Gap” setting where you can fill colors, even with gaps in your lines.
I really like using Clip Studio for animation because I’m very used it as I use it for illustrations as well. It’s not too robust in animation and hope they add essential features in the future, like the scrubbing you mentioned!
Last thing I wanna say is that the max pixel height for exporting a gif is 2000px and the max height for making a movie is 1080px. That’s why I’m trying Harmony more and to play with audio more!
EDIT: Also what is really helpful is that Animation Folders can Clip onto other layers and folders. This is really helpful when you want to add shadows to your colors.
